The present invention concerns a perovskite solar cell provided with a polymer-porous template composite material for absorbing toxic metal ions. Preferably, the porous template material is a metal oxide framework (MOF) material. An example of a preferred polymer-porous template composite material is PDA-Fe-BTC (polydopamine-Fe1,3,5-benzenetricarboxylate). In experiments mimicking breakage of the solar cell modules, the presence of the polymer-MOF material was shown to result in the capture of lead and thus to reduced leakage of lead.
